Signup
Login
Depesche Trademarks
DEPESCHE
Rugs; Automobile carpets; Barbecue grill floor mats; Carpet underlay; Non-slip mats for baths; Underlays for rugs
Registered
·
July 25, 2023
·
98099990
·
Previous
1
Next